Storm damages school construction site

Defiance City Board of Education held a special meeting Monday afternoon, learning about storm damage at the grades 6-12 construction site.
Superintendent Mike Struble told the board that a strong storm on last Wednesday evening damaged the Palmer Drive construction site. With concrete block walls going up, there was damage to a high school wall and a middle school wall, located in separate wings. He noted that the builders risk insurance agent was on the scene to assess the damage. He said the damaged areas are nearly all cleaned up and it would have set the workers back two weeks, but crews were already two to three weeks ahead of schedule so construction is still on time.
